Setting Out from Punta Cana
The tour departs from Punta Cana, with pickup included—be ready 10 minutes early for a smooth start. The vessel, called Lucky Lady, is described as a comfortable and well-maintained catamaran. Upon boarding, the scene is set for a lively, tropical outing, with the crew often engaging guests in Caribbean music and dance. This start is as much about soaking in the scenery as it is about getting into the festive spirit of the Caribbean.

The main adventure for many is the snorkeling stop at The Natural Pool. This spot is known for its turquoise waters and vibrant marine life. You’ll have the opportunity to swim and float amidst colorful fish and coral reefs, as described by a reviewer who loved discovering marine species and “colorful coral reefs.” The water is crystal-clear, making it easier to spot marine creatures.
Some guests, like Inmaculada from Spain, shared how the team was wonderful, and they enjoyed both the beach of Bávaro and the snorkeling experience. The reviews highlight the ease of snorkeling, with enough time to enjoy the surroundings without feeling rushed. FAQ

How long is the Power Cruise Tour?
The tour lasts approximately 3 hours, making it a manageable but fulfilling experience suitable for travelers with limited time.
What should I bring?
Bring a towel, camera, and sunscreen to stay comfortable and capture memories. Sunscreen is crucial to protect against the Caribbean sun.
Can I cancel the tour?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, which offers peace of mind if your plans change unexpectedly.
Is the tour suitable for children?
Children under 3 years old and pregnant women are not recommended to participate, due to safety and health considerations.
What is the snorkeling like?
The snorkeling occurs at The Natural Pool, known for clear waters and colorful marine life. It’s suitable for beginners and experienced snorkelers alike.
